Energetic ventilation distributes by proactively drawing outside air right into your home and pressing inside air out of your home. Easy air flow flows making use of natural pressures like wind and thermal buoyancy. Passive ventilation is a greener option, but it is not as constant as active air flow. A complete roofing system substitute is simply what it appears like: complete. Unlike re-roofing, which includes setting a brand-new layer of tiles in addition to your old roof material, a complete roof covering substitute entails detaching every layer of your roof covering and changing it. This is why some firms call it a "tear-off" roof covering.


Decking: The decking is a substantial layer of protection for your home, generally consisting of a series of flat boards attached to the joists or trusses - Gutter installation Nebraska.


The Ultimate Guide To Weathercraft


Underlayment: This essential layer goes in-between the decking and the roof shingles. Underlayment is a water-proof or water-resistant layer connected straight to the roof covering deck, and uses an added level of protection from serious weather condition. Blinking: A thin however necessary roof element, flashing is made use of to route water far from at risk locations of the roof covering, particularly where an area of roof covering fulfills a vertical surface like a wall or smokeshaft.
